Output 5a631303d8faa879f208b1bb2a70068e1aa992650d14986fcf1a2e39b584b254:0

value
9292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 852a8d3d9896c80f7b8ed62fe715178f923ff254 OP_EQUAL
address
3Dq8mbuTBPpd5rbF91s6xT4JGwywZyYYus
transaction
5a631303d8faa879f208b1bb2a70068e1aa992650d14986fcf1a2e39b584b254
confirmations
438108
spent
true